Yes, good eye! - it is Winston Churchill 'Redoubtable' X fairrieanum.
I think my "problem" with blooming these has been a lack of patience (once I stopped over-watering; not enough that the plant looked over-watered, but roots left something to be desired). I know I was disappointed when it did not bloom last winter, but then when the fan started growing a new leaf in spring, I realized that it couldn't have bloomed last season, since the fan hadn't finished growing yet! Same for my delanatii - I was hoping it would bloom last spring, and was disappointed it didn't, until the biggest two fans both started new leaves - just not done growing! ;p Keeping fingers crossed that that one will bloom soon!
